Description
The data acquisition system for the CMS experiment at the Large Hadron Collider (LHC) will require a large and high performance event building network. Several architectures and switch technologies are currently being evaluated. The authors describe demonstrators which have been set up to study a small-scale event builder based on PCs emulating high performance sources and sinks connected via Ethernet or Myrinet switches. Results from ongoing studies, including measurements on throughput and scaling, are presented
